Output 05ab139622bcde20fc72030b3a4c0dc1ddc23345ce28dd928ffa16fd8a3f88dc:0

value
218109
script pubkey
OP_0 OP_PUSHBYTES_20 2719623953893a2f15487c6a8b3dfaee124cc6a5
address
bc1qyuvkyw2n3yaz792g034gk006acfye3494rrcqh
transaction
05ab139622bcde20fc72030b3a4c0dc1ddc23345ce28dd928ffa16fd8a3f88dc
confirmations
345
spent
true